The 1999 Braves were an absolute powerhouse, posting a dominant 103-59 regular season record behind the legendary trio of Greg Maddux, Tom Glavine, and John Smoltz. What made this team special was their incredible playoff run, sweeping the Houston Astros in the Division Series and then pulling off a thrilling six-game victory over the New York Mets in the NLCS. The series against the Mets was particularly memorable, featuring multiple extra-inning games and clutch performances from veterans like Chipper Jones and Brian Jordan, who helped deliver Atlanta their fifth National League pennant of the decade.
